Have booked to fly Virgin from Manchester in August. Anyone travelled with them on this flight (747 Economy) - 2 adults 2 kids. Your are comments are welcomed - any good or bad reports? Are the flights as good as their website suggests?
 
We should have been with Virgin three weeks ago but got bumped off on to Continental.

The word I'm hearing from people who have been on VA recently is that the Air Atlanta Iceland (sic) flights are very good and better than the last few years Virgin Atlantic flights.
 
Arrived from this flight this morning and cannot say anything bad about it, good movies, nintendo games and food. We found the Economy seats satisfactory for us but there was a family by the side of us and the adults were quite large people and they struggled with the seating space espcially when the people in front of them reclined their seat, they were having to hold their plates in their hands and eat as they just did'nt have the room.
 


I'm flying out on Tuesday from Manchester. I didn't understand the Icelandic stuff on the tickets, and wasn't worrying unduly until reading this thread. Do we know whether the seat sizes and baggage allowance is the normal Virgin standard. I've read the thread listed by MickeyMcMouse and it doesn't mention either. Hope someone is in the know.

Ian,

There is no need to worry, it is a virgin plane (Island Lady) with virgin crew it is just the registration of the plane belongs to Icelandic. I have flew with Virgin before to Miami and it is exactly the same. Hope you get better weather than we had, it was very rainy and hot but still had a fantasic time.
